1 Star 0 Fork 18

小蚂蚁/jPreview

forked from Raingad/jPreview 
加入 Gitee
与超过 1200万 开发者一起发现、参与优秀开源项目,私有仓库也完全免费 :)
免费加入
克隆/下载
preview.html 2.21 KB
一键复制 编辑 原始数据 按行查看 历史
律者 提交于 2023-05-08 22:01 . 优化结构
<!DOCTYPE html>
<html lang="zh">
<head>
<meta charset="UTF-8">
<meta http-equiv="X-UA-Compatible" content="IE=edge,chrome=1">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>文件预览插件</title>
<link rel="stylesheet" href="static/common/css/main.css">
<link rel="stylesheet" href="https://unpkg.com/element-ui@2.15.13/lib/theme-chalk/index.css">
<link rel="stylesheet" href="static/common/css/audio.css">
<link rel="stylesheet" href="static/luckysheet/css/pluginsCss.css">
<link rel="stylesheet" href="static/luckysheet/css/plugins.css">
<link rel="stylesheet" href="static/luckysheet/css/luckysheet.css">
<link rel="stylesheet" href="static/luckysheet/css/iconfont.css">
<link rel="stylesheet" href="static/pptxjs/css/pptxjs.css">
<link rel="stylesheet" href="static/pptxjs/css/nv.d3.min.css">
</head>
<body>
<div id="el-app">
<div id="container">
</div>
</div>
<!-- built files will be auto injected -->
<script type="text/javascript" src="static/jquery-2.0.3.min.js"></script>
<script type="text/javascript" src="https://unpkg.com/vue@2.7.14/dist/vue.js"></script>
<script src="https://unpkg.com/element-ui@2.15.13/lib/index.js"></script>
<script type="text/javascript" src="static/jPreview.js"></script>
<script>
var app = new Vue({
delimiters: ['${', '}'],
el: '#el-app',
data(){
return {
loading: true,
};
},
created(){
const loading = this.$loading({
lock: true,
text: '资源加载中...',
spinner: 'el-icon-loading',
background: 'rgba(0, 0, 0, 0.9)'
});
this.$nextTick(function(){
jPreview.preview({
container:"container", // 容器id
staticPath:"./static", // 静态资源路径
url:"", // 预览资源路径,没有的话获取url中scr参数
ext:"", // 资源后缀,如果url中没有的话,必须传入后缀名,否则无法识别文件类型
name:"", // 资源名称
watermarkTxt:"文件预览系统", // 水印文字
watermarkSize:"", // 水印文字大小
priority:1, // 优先级 1:使用插件预览 2:使用office在线预览,
oburl:"", // 可自动设置在线设置office线上预览地址,不需要的话可以不传
});
loading.close();
})
}
})
</script>
</body>
</html>
马建仓 AI 助手
尝试更多
代码解读
代码找茬
代码优化
JavaScript
1
https://gitee.com/rencp_home/j-preview.git
git@gitee.com:rencp_home/j-preview.git
rencp_home
j-preview
jPreview
master

搜索帮助